summ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--app/assets/stylesheets/pages/profile.scss22
-rw-r--r--app/views/users/show.html.haml27
2 files changed, 38 insertions, 11 deletions
diff --git a/app/assets/stylesheets/pages/profile.scss b/app/assets/stylesheets/pages/profile.scss
index b7391e5303b..1d6ca0dfc13 100644
--- a/app/assets/stylesheets/pages/profile.scss
+++ b/app/assets/stylesheets/pages/profile.scss
@@ -53,3 +53,25 @@
float: right;
font-size: 12px;
}
+
+.profile-link-holder {
+ display: inline;
+
+ &:after {
+ content: "\00B7";
+ padding: 0px 6px;
+ font-weight: bold;
+ }
+
+ &:last-child {
+ &:after {
+ content: "";
+ padding: 0;
+ }
+ }
+
+ a {
+ color: $blue-dark;
+ text-decoration: none;
+ }
+}
diff --git a/app/views/users/show.html.haml b/app/views/users/show.html.haml
index 4ea4a1f92c2..3766d8cd673 100644
--- a/app/views/users/show.html.haml
+++ b/app/views/users/show.html.haml
@@ -24,22 +24,27 @@
.cover-desc
- unless @user.public_email.blank?
- = link_to @user.public_email, "mailto:#{@user.public_email}"
+ .profile-link-holder
+ = link_to @user.public_email, "mailto:#{@user.public_email}"
- unless @user.skype.blank?
- ·
- = link_to "Skype", "skype:#{@user.skype}"
+ .profile-link-holder
+ = link_to "skype:#{@user.skype}", title: "Skype" do
+ = icon('skype')
- unless @user.linkedin.blank?
- ·
- = link_to "LinkedIn", "http://www.linkedin.com/in/#{@user.linkedin}"
+ .profile-link-holder
+ = link_to "http://www.linkedin.com/in/#{@user.linkedin}", title: "LinkedIn" do
+ = icon('linkedin-square')
- unless @user.twitter.blank?
- ·
- = link_to "Twitter", "http://www.twitter.com/#{@user.twitter}"
+ .profile-link-holder
+ = link_to "http://www.twitter.com/#{@user.twitter}", title: "Twitter" do
+ = icon('twitter-square')
- unless @user.website_url.blank?
- ·
- = link_to @user.short_website_url, @user.full_website_url
+ .profile-link-holder
+ = link_to @user.short_website_url, @user.full_website_url
- unless @user.location.blank?
- ·
- = @user.location
+ .profile-link-holder
+ = icon('map-marker')
+ = @user.location
.cover-controls